Plant-Based Mediterranean Chickpea Stew

This Mediterranean Vegetable and Chickpea Stew is a vibrant, wholesome dish that’s both satisfying and nourishing.

Packed with fiber-rich vegetables, protein from chickpeas, and heart-healthy fats from coconut oil, it’s a low-saturated-fat, plant-based option perfect for any day of the week.

Roasting the vegetables enhances their natural sweetness while keeping preparation quick and simple, making it ideal for meal prep or a weeknight dinner.

Flavorful, nutrient-dense, and endlessly versatile, this stew is a guilt-free, comforting way to enjoy a balanced, Mediterranean-inspired meal.

Quick Mediterranean Chickpea Stew

Jessica T. Brown
A colorful, plant-based Mediterranean stew with roasted vegetables, chickpeas, and tomato sauce.
Quick, easy, and high in protein and fiber, it’s perfect for weeknight dinners or meal prep.
Serve over rice, quinoa, or enjoy as a hearty soup.
Prep Time 15 minutes
Cook Time 40 minutes
Total Time 55 minutes
Course Main Dish
Cuisine Mediterranean
Servings 4

Equipment

  • 1 large roasting pan
  • 1 large pot or saucepan
  • 1 knife1 cutting board
  • 1 spatula or wooden spoon

Ingredients
  

  • 1 medium eggplant cubed
  • 1 yellow bell pepper chopped
  • 1 green bell pepper chopped
  • 1 medium red onion chopped
  • cups butternut squash cubed (or ½ medium squash)
  • 1 –2 small zucchinis sliced
  • 3 garlic cloves smashed with skins on
  • 1 tbsp dried oregano or mixed dried herbs
  • 2 tbsp fresh parsley finely chopped
  • 1 –2 tbsp coconut oil
  • 1 can 400 g tomato sauce or chopped tomatoes
  • 1 can 400 g chickpeas, drained and rinsed (or 1½ cups cooked chickpeas)
  • Sea salt and black pepper to taste
  • ½ cup vegetable stock optional

Instructions
 

  • Preheat the Oven: Begin by setting your oven to 220°C (425°F) to preheat while you prep the vegetables.
    Preheating ensures the vegetables roast evenly and develop a deep, caramelized flavor.
    Place the oven rack in the center position for optimal heat distribution.
  • Prepare the Vegetables: Wash all vegetables thoroughly under cold running water. Pat them dry with a clean kitchen towel.
    Cube the eggplant into bite-sized pieces, roughly chop the yellow and green bell peppers, slice the zucchinis into rounds, and chop the red onion into large chunks.
    Peel the butternut squash (if using fresh) and cube into approximately 1-inch pieces.
    Keep the garlic cloves whole, just smashing them lightly with the side of a knife while leaving the skins on to roast.
  • Season the Vegetables: Transfer all the chopped vegetables and smashed garlic into a large roasting pan.
    Drizzle with 1–2 tablespoons of coconut oil, making sure every piece is lightly coated.
    Sprinkle sea salt, black pepper, and 1 tablespoon of dried oregano (or your favorite mixed herbs) over the vegetables.
    Toss everything gently with your hands or a spatula until evenly coated with oil and seasonings.
    This step ensures that each bite is flavorful and aromatic.
  • Roast the Vegetables: Place the roasting pan in the preheated oven and allow the vegetables to roast for 20–25 minutes.
    Stir the vegetables halfway through cooking to ensure even browning.
    Keep an eye on them—your goal is tender, lightly caramelized vegetables that are not mushy, as they will continue cooking in the stew later.
    Roasting concentrates the natural sweetness and adds depth to the final dish.
  • Prepare the Stew Base: While the vegetables are roasting, pour the tomato sauce (or chopped tomatoes) into a large pot or saucepan over medium heat. Add a pinch of sea salt and black pepper, and stir to combine. This will be the flavorful base of your stew, and warming it while the vegetables roast helps the flavors meld seamlessly.
  • Add Chickpeas: Drain and rinse the chickpeas if using canned, or ensure your cooked chickpeas are tender.
    Stir them into the pot with the tomato sauce.
    Allow the chickpeas to heat through for 2–3 minutes.
    Chickpeas not only provide a protein boost but also add a creamy texture and hearty bite to the stew.
  • Combine Roasted Vegetables with the Stew Base: Once the vegetables are perfectly roasted, carefully transfer them from the roasting pan into the pot with the tomato-chickpea base.
    Stir gently to combine, being careful not to mash the vegetables.
    Taste the mixture and adjust seasoning with additional sea salt, black pepper, or herbs as desired.
  • Simmer to Enhance Flavors: Reduce the heat to low-medium and allow the stew to simmer gently for 5 minutes.
    If you prefer a more liquid consistency, stir in up to ½ cup of vegetable stock.
    Simmering allows the roasted flavors to meld with the tomato sauce and chickpeas, creating a rich, aromatic, and well-balanced stew.
  • Add Fresh Herbs: Just before serving, stir in 2 tablespoons of finely chopped fresh parsley.
    Fresh herbs add brightness and a burst of color, elevating the dish with their fragrance and subtle taste.
  • Serve the Stew: Spoon the stew over a bed of baby spinach, brown rice, quinoa, or a combination of both.
    For a more casual option, serve it with wholewheat pasta or enjoy it as a hearty soup.
    Each serving provides a nourishing, satisfying meal that’s rich in fiber, protein, and healthy fats.
  • Optional Meal Prep & Storage Tips: This stew keeps beautifully in an airtight container in the refrigerator for up to 4–5 days.
    It also freezes well for up to 2 months.
    Reheat gently on the stovetop or in the microwave, adding a splash of vegetable stock if needed to restore its saucy consistency.

Notes

  • Use seasonal or fresh vegetables for the best flavor; frozen vegetables can be used but may result in a slightly softer texture.
  • Adjust the level of herbs according to your taste—oregano, thyme, rosemary, or parsley all work beautifully.
  • Roasting vegetables enhances natural sweetness but avoid overcooking to maintain texture.
  • Coconut oil adds a subtle richness; olive oil can be substituted if preferred.
  • The stew is versatile; add a splash of vegetable stock to make it more soup-like or leave thick for a hearty main dish.
  • This recipe is naturally vegan and gluten-free.

Chef’s Secrets for Maximum Flavor

To achieve a deeply flavorful stew, take time during the roasting step.

Roasting vegetables at a high temperature caramelizes their natural sugars, intensifying the taste of the dish.

Don’t overcrowd the pan—spread the vegetables evenly to allow air circulation and even browning.

For an extra layer of flavor, lightly toast your spices in the pan with a splash of oil before adding them to the stew base.

Finally, fresh herbs added at the end elevate the aroma and taste without overpowering the vegetables.

Serving Suggestions to Try Today

This stew is wonderfully versatile.

Serve it over fluffy brown rice, a mix of quinoa and rice, or wholewheat pasta for a hearty meal.

For a lighter option, enjoy it as a warm topping on salad greens or baby spinach.

Garnish with extra fresh parsley or a squeeze of lemon to add brightness.

Pair with crusty bread for dipping, or a side of roasted chickpeas for added crunch.

It’s a perfect weeknight dinner or a meal-prep option for busy schedules.

Storage Tips for Longevity

The stew stores beautifully in the refrigerator for up to 4–5 days in an airtight container.

Let it cool to room temperature before sealing to preserve freshness.

For longer storage, freeze portions in freezer-safe containers for up to two months.

When reheating, warm gently on the stovetop or microwave, adding a splash of vegetable stock or water if the consistency has thickened.

Freezing and reheating may slightly soften the vegetables, but the flavors remain rich and comforting.

Frequently Asked Questions Answered

1. Can I use canned or frozen vegetables?

Yes! Canned or frozen vegetables can be substituted in a pinch. Frozen vegetables should be thawed and drained to avoid excess water, which can make the stew runny. Canned vegetables work best if lightly drained and patted dry. Roasting frozen vegetables is possible, but they may cook unevenly and release extra moisture.

2. What can I use instead of coconut oil?

Olive oil is a perfect substitute for coconut oil. It provides a slightly different flavor but still gives the vegetables a delicious roasted texture. Other neutral oils like avocado or sunflower oil can also be used.

3. How do I make the stew spicier?

Add a pinch of red chili flakes while roasting the vegetables or stir in a small amount of harissa paste, cayenne, or smoked paprika during the simmering step. Start with a little and taste as you go to achieve the desired heat level.

4. Can I make this recipe gluten-free?

Absolutely! The recipe is naturally gluten-free as written, especially when served with rice, quinoa, or gluten-free pasta. Ensure that any stock or pre-packaged tomato sauce you use is certified gluten-free to avoid hidden sources of gluten.

5. Can this stew be made ahead for meal prep?

Yes! This stew is excellent for meal prep. Prepare it completely, then store in individual airtight containers. It reheats well and the flavors continue to develop overnight in the refrigerator. For freezer storage, portion it into containers and thaw in the fridge overnight before reheating.

Jessica T. Brown

Jessica T. Brown is the founder of KitchenHush.com, a platform born out of her deep love for cooking and the quiet joy found in the kitchen. From a young age, Jessica discovered that the kitchen wasn't just a place to prepare meals—it was a space for connection, creativity, and comfort. Inspired by those early memories, she created Kitchen Hush to share that experience with home cooks everywhere.

Leave a Comment

Recipe Rating